The best place to check is EBAY. Just check daily. I got mine off there, they are the real Lexus taillights, Ithink I paid $250 or some ridiculously low price like that.

If you want the Black Altezza type you can get them from www.procarparts.com or off EBAY also.

If you are installing these on a 1999 or 2000, you have to do a little modifying to your bulbs/sockets to make them fit. I had to, it was kind of a pain, but I got the look I was going for. The newer look!

I believe those step by step instructions only work if you buy the aftermarket Altezza taillights, because they come with a new wire harness. The Lexus dealer told me the 2001-2002 wire harness will not work in a 1999-2000 model. The wire harness that comes with the Aftermarket taillights is NOT a Lexus wire harness. I had to do some real modifying to make mine work, since I bought Real Lexus taillights. I wish it was as simple as replacing a harness.

I used my old wire harness, since the Lexus dealer said using the 2001-2002 wire harness would mess everything up. I didn't want to fry any wires and have to re-do the wiring or pay someone to re-do the wiring so I didn't want to try replacing it. Sometimes the dealers aren't always right when they say something can't be done, but I didn't want to chance it.

The brake light bulb fit fine, it was the blinker that was different. I ended up using a Master Cylinder Gasket from a Chrysler as an adapter. It looks like a big rubber grommet. Basically I had to make the new taillight hole smaller for the older blinker socket to fit into. I had to shove the socket into the rubber grommet after I shoved the rubber grommet into the taillight.

I know it sounds really MacGyver'ish, but it actually works/worked really well. Since the Master Cylinder gasket is rubber it molds itself into all the gaps and makes everything "condensation" proof. The bulbs have never wiggled themselves back out, I think it helps that the end of the bulb socket fits right up snug against the body of the vehicle.

I did have to paint my original bulbs orange, because the older 1999-2000 taillights have an orange lens with clear bulbs but the newer lights have an orange bulb and clear lens. I couldn't find anyone who made a GOOD quality orange bulb so I just painted mine with transparent, heat proof glass paint from a craft store.

The front headlights are the headlights off a 2001-2002 RX. The inner part is chrome rather than the black inner part. I got the headlights for $300 for both off eBay. They are aftermarket made by TYC. The quality seems the same as the Lexus ones. They are halogen by the way NOT HID. A lot of people ask that question.
